Gene engineering illustrates a trailblazing breakthrough in state-of-the-art medical science. By engineering the fundamental source of a disease at the DNA level, genetic engineering introduces a innovative treatment path to typical treatments that commonly only relieve symptoms.
Defining Genetic Therapy?
Gene therapy represents a clinical methodology that incorporates modifying an individual's genetic material to address or avert disease. This is carried out through multiple procedures, including:
Gene Insertion Therapy – Integrating a functional genomic material to restore a damaged or deleted counterpart.
Gene Knockdown – Suppressing the function of deleterious mutated segments.
Gene Editing – Meticulously adjusting the genetic code using state-of-the-art techniques like gene scissors.
Cellular Gene Engineering – Genetically engineering organic tissues outside the body and implanting them into the recipient.
This pioneering discipline has evolved exponentially with the breakthroughs of biotechnology, opening up opportunities to manage medical issues earlier viewed as non-treatable.

Genetic Carriers
Microbes have developed to efficiently deliver genetic material into recipient cells, making them an effective tool for gene therapy. Common viral vectors consist of:
Adenoviral vectors – Designed to invade both dividing and non-dividing cells but may provoke immune responses.
AAV vectors – Favorable due to their reduced immune response and potential to ensure long-term DNA transcription.
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the recipient's DNA, ensuring long-lasting genetic alteration,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ly advantageous for targeting non-dividing cells.
Non-Viral Vectors
Alternative gene transport techniques offer a reduced-risk option,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These include:
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Coating DNA or RNA for efficient intracellular transport.
Electrical Permeabilization –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in biological enclosures,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.
Targeted Genetic Infusion – Introducing genetic material directly into localized cells.
Medical Uses of Genetic Modification
DNA-based interventions have proven effective across various healthcare sectors, profoundly influencing the management of genetic disorders, cancer, and pathogen-induced ailments.
Addressing Inherited Diseases
Numerous inherited conditions originate in single-gene mutations, rendering them suitable targets for gene therapy. Key developments comprise:
CFTR Mutation Disorder – Research aiming to incorporate functional CFTR genes have demonstrated positive outcomes.
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ials focus on regenerating the production of clotting factors.
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-driven genetic correction offers hope for DMD-affected individuals.
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Genomic treatment approaches aim to rectify hemoglobin defects.
DNA-Based Oncology Solutions
Genetic modification is integral in tumor management, either by altering T-cell functionality to target malignant cells or by directly altering cancerous cells to halt metastasis. Key innovative oncogenetic treatments feature:
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Modified lymphocytes targeting specific cancer antigens.
Oncolytic Viruses – Genetically modified pathogens that exclusively invade and eradicate cancerous growths.
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reestablishing the efficacy of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.
Care of Infectious Illnesses
Genetic modification provides plausible therapies for chronic illnesses including retroviral disease. Prototype procedures include:
CRISPR-driven HIV Intervention – Aiming at and neutralizing virus-afflicted cells.
Gene Editing of Defensive Cells – Making Lymphocytes impervious to pathogen infiltration.

The Scientific Basis of Gene and Cell Therapy
Cell Therapy: Harnessing the Power of Living Cells
Living cell therapy utilizes the renewal abilities of cellular functions to address health conditions. Major innovations encompass:
Hematopoietic Stem Cell Grafts:
Used to restore blood cell function in patients by infusing healthy stem cells via matched cellular replacements.
CAR-T Immunotherapy: A game-changing cancer treatment in which a person’s lymphocytes are modified to identify more effectively and destroy tumorous cells.
Mesenchymal Stem Cell Therapy: Investigated for its potential in counteracting autoimmune-related illnesses, skeletal trauma, and progressive neural ailments.
Genetic Modification Treatment: Modifying the Molecular Structure
Gene therapy operates via correcting the root cause of DNA-related illnesses:
In Vivo Gene Therapy: Transfers modified genes directly into the biological structure, such as the regulatory-approved Luxturna for managing inherited blindness.
External Genetic Modification: Utilizes reprogramming a biological samples externally and then reinfusing them, as utilized in some experimental treatments for red blood cell disorders and immune deficiencies.
The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has rapidly progressed gene therapy research, enabling high-precision adjustments at the DNA level.
Cutting-Edge Advancements in Modern Treatment
Cell and gene therapies are revolutionizing medical approaches in different branches:
Tumor Therapies
The endorsement of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has reshaped the malignancy-fighting methods, particularly for cancer sufferers with refractory hematologic diseases who have failed standard treatments.
Genetic Conditions
Diseases for instance spinal muscular atrophy along with a severe hemoglobinopathy, that in the past offered limited treatment options, at present offer groundbreaking gene therapy solutions like a gene replacement therapy as well as Casgevy.
